相关文章
15分钟学 Go 第 30 天:测试基础
第30天:测试基础
学习目标
今天的目标是掌握如何在Go语言中编写测试。我们将讨论Go语言的测试框架、编写有效测试的方法、使用基准测试和表驱动测试的技巧,以及如何评估和运行测试。
1. 测试的重要性
在软件开发中,测试是确保代码质量和稳…
建站知识
2024/11/3 1:23:55
npm入门教程14:npm依赖管理
一、依赖管理概述
在软件开发过程中,项目往往依赖于外部库或框架。npm允许开发者通过简单的命令来安装、更新、卸载这些依赖,并自动管理它们之间的版本关系。
二、依赖类型
npm中的依赖主要分为以下几类:
dependencies(生产环…
建站知识
2024/11/3 1:22:53
Python CGI编程-cookie的设置、检索
设置检索 其他:
1. http.cookies和http.cookiejar区别: http.cookies主要用于创建和操作单个cookie对象,适用于需要精细控制单个cookie属性的场景。http.cookiejar则用于管理多个cookie,适用于需要自动处理多个请求和响应中的coo…
建站知识
2024/11/3 1:21:52
SpringBoot项目中枚举类的作用
在 Spring Boot 项目中,枚举类(enum)的作用是提供一种更清晰、更安全的方式来定义一组常量。枚举类的使用有多个优点和作用,尤其在处理特定类型的值时。以下是枚举类在 Spring Boot 项目中的一些主要作用:
1. 增强代码…
建站知识
2024/11/3 1:20:51
Mybatis Plus 自定义 SQL
一、在 mapper 层自定义查询方法
Mapper
public interface UserTableMapper extends BaseMapper<UserTableEntity> {/*** 自定义查询方法* param username 用户名*/List<UserTableEntity> selectAllByUsername(Param("username") String username);
}pa…
建站知识
2024/11/3 1:19:49
数据结构+算法设计与分析[名词解释版]
名词解释
数据结构
1)数据:数据是信息的载体,是描述客观事物属性的数、字符及所有能输入到计算机中并被计算机程序识别和处理的符号的集合。
数据是对客观事物的符号表示,在计算机科学中是指所有能输入到计算机中,并…
建站知识
2024/11/3 1:18:48
Node.js:Express 中间件 CORS 跨域资源共享
Node.js:Express 中间件 & CORS 中间件全局中间件局部中间件分类错误级中间件内置中间件 CORS原理预检请求 中间件
中间件是不直接接收请求,也不直接发送响应,而是在这之间处理一个中间过程的组件。 当一个请求到来,会经过多…
建站知识
2024/11/3 1:17:47